How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tyrone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Tyrone Park Studio Apartments | $1,293 | $1,210 | $1,338 |
Tyrone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,448 | $1,175 | $1,650 |
Tyrone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,731 | $1,495 | $2,014 |
Tyrone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,724 | $2,670 | $2,778 |
